The company behind the popular and arguably largest computer security software brand is Symantec.
Founded in 1982 by what the company calls visionary computer scientists, it now enjoys revenues of $6.2 billion (for the year ended April, 2009) and is number 419 on the Fortune 500 list of top companies. From its headquarters in California and from offices worldwide, it employs over 17,000 people.
Some $1.8 billion of revenue comes from the consumer market, the rest from businesses and enterprises, with the Americas counting for the largest part of its sales (55%).
Symantec is not just computer security of course, it also provides storage and systems management solutions to its many clients.

If you take one of Norton’s latest products, say the 360 Version 4.0 Premier Edition which comes with a licence to protect three home PCs, you can quickly see how the company put their philosophy into action by evolving their software.
The Norton 360 Version 4.0 Premier Edition boasts a number of new features, including a Reputation Service, a Norton Insight, a Web-based access to back-up files and a Sonar 2 Behavioural Projection. Improvements on the existing features include enhancements to the Automated Backup and Restore, Start-up Manager, Professional-Strength AntiSpam, Anti-Phishing and Parental Controls.
You then add to this the core features and capabilities, including Antivirus, Antispyware, Bot Protection, Identity Protection, Norton Safe Web, Smart Firewall, PC Tuneup, Norton Browser Protection and Pulse Updates.
